Ohau Dairy Herd Sales At Good Prices
— ' ■ " >& ' A very satisfaetory average .of £18 10s was realised for the dairy hferd offered at a clfearing sale this week on beha'f of Mr. J. j. Guerin, of Ohau, by the New Zealand Loan and Mercantile Agency Co., Ltd., the. 47 Jersev-Priesian cross cows, mainly Secori(f and third calvers, came forward iii good Condition. They had high producing records and met with a keen demand from the 'arge bench of buvers, who came from Taranaki and as fdr south as Tawa Flat, with a strong district represen'ation. The following is a range of the prices realised: — Cows in milk. £18, £26 10s, £29, £31; June calving do., £19, £21, £25 10s, £27; July caWing do., £15, £18 10s, £20 10s, £25 10s; August calving *do., £10 10s. £14, £16 10s, £18. £20: weaner heifers, £7 10s; three-year Jersey bul1. £8; seven-year mare. £30. A total clearance of the suhdries was effected at full late rates.
